About
A stable emollient ester from tea seed (Camellia) oil and its hydrogenated form — lightweight, fast-absorbing, and barrier-friendly. Long history in East Asian skincare; very mild risk profile.
Skin benefits
- Stable emolliency
- Lightweight skin feel
- High-oleic barrier support
Known concerns
- Possible trace hydrogenation catalyst residues
- Limited formal SCCS review
